Emotion Recognition in Women’s Voices and Its Application to Improve Mood Through Light Color Control

摘要

This paper presents a project focused on recognizing emotions in women’s voices and its application to improve mood through light color control. Using a dataset of 51 audio recordings of women saying “Good morning” with different emotions, a program was developed in MATLAB to recognize specific emotions in real-time. Tests were conducted with different age groups to evaluate the effectiveness of the program in identifying emotions. Additionally, a simulation of color change in an LED bulb was carried out and compared with another bulb controlled via Wi-Fi. While the first approach showed promising results, limitations were identified in Wi-Fi communication with the second bulb. The results indicate variable effectiveness in emotion recognition, with higher accuracy for sadness and anger compared to happiness. Despite current limitations due to data and resource availability, the project demonstrates the potential of technology to enhance emotional well-being through practical applications.
